The standard Golden Triangle — Delhi, Agra, Jaipur — covers Mughal architecture and one Rajput city in 5–7 days, and works well for travelers with limited time. Extending into Rajasthan, toward Jodhpur, Udaipur and Jaisalmer, adds 5–7 more days and shifts the trip's centre of gravity from monuments toward desert landscapes, lake palaces, and living fort cities. The decision usually comes down to time: under a week, stay with the Triangle; two weeks or more, the Rajasthan extension is worth it.
